The Northern Technical University organized a seminar titled (Green Technology: Iraq’s Path to Sustainable Development) under the patronage of the university president, Professor Dr. Aliyah Abbas Al-Attar, and under the supervision of Assistant Professor Dr. Ashti Mahdi Aref, Dean of the Technical Institute/Kirkuk. The Women’s Affairs Unit organized the seminar titled (Green Technology: Iraq’s Path to Sustainable Development).
The speakers included:
1- Ms. Najiba Muhammad Rashid, Head of the Women’s Affairs Unit.
2- Ms. Hadeel Ali Hassan, Member of the Coordinating Committee of the Women’s Affairs Unit.
The seminar highlighted that green technology encompasses technologies designed to reduce negative environmental impacts. These innovations include renewable energy systems, sustainable transportation, and recycling using modern techniques.
The seminar aimed to familiarize attendees and students with applications of green technology, which include renewable energy systems and the establishment of solar and wind energy stations to reduce reliance on fossil fuels and improve energy consumption efficiency. It also focused on developing buildings that rely on solar panels and advanced thermal insulation systems, as well as wastewater treatment. Conceptually, wastewater treatment is similar to water purification. Wastewater treatment is very important as it purifies water according to pollution levels. Heavily polluted water is not used for anything, while less polluted water is provided to places that require significant water use.
